A logistics dispatcher is a professional responsible for **coordinating the movement of goods** through a company's supply chain, ensuring shipments are picked up and delivered on time and efficiently. They act as the central communication point between drivers, customers, and internal teams, managing schedules, optimizing routes, and resolving issues in real time.

**Responsibilities**
- **Route Planning and Optimization**: Using software to map the most efficient routes for drivers, considering factors like traffic, weather, and delivery windows to reduce costs and transit times.
- **Driver Coordination and Communication**: Assigning drivers and vehicles to specific orders and maintaining constant communication via phone, radio, or messaging to provide instructions, updates, and support.
- **Scheduling**: Setting pickup and delivery appointments with shippers, receivers, and distribution centers.
- **Tracking and Monitoring**: Utilizing GPS and transportation management systems (TMS) to monitor the real-time location and status of drivers and shipments, taking action to address delays or complications.
- **Problem Solving and Emergency Response**: Proactively identifying and resolving logístical challenges such as vehicle breakdowns, accidents, or customs problems to minimize disruptions to the supply chain.
- **Documentation and Record Keeping**: Maintaining accurate logs and records of all dispatch activities, including driver hours of service (HOS), delivery confirmations (PODs), and billing information to ensure compliance with regulations.
- **Customer Service**: Liaising with customers to provide updates, address inquiries, manage complaints, and ensure high levels of satisfaction.
- **Compliance**: Ensuring that all drivers and equipment comply with corporate safety standards and all applicable local, provincial, and federal transportation laws and regulations.
- **Fleet Management**: Ensuring that fleet vehicles are mechanically serviced with mínimal interruption to our daily activities and that maintenance is properly recorded.
